I think you can get some pseudo conventional reverb sounds out of the Afterneath, but they are more in the way of long plates and hall reverbs. You definitely won't get spring or room reverbs out of this guy, or at least I haven't been able to yet. You can get that "pad" kind of reverb sound that sits behind whatever you play pretty easily. I really love gated reverbs, and I feel like this pedal can nail that sound with the length knob turned all the way down. I still need to play around with the Afterneath some more to get it fully figured out (especially the drag knob) but so far I think it's a really fun pedal.
